Output 8c20dfd799e5237170c397bfb54756dcab0c7294d9bd6c5b53036b354cd8d0b0:63

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ebd6b3c27e1822871c264ecb915476db0290bc46207eed7891f1fcac0fd5ad6
address
bc1pd67kk0p8uxpzsuwzvnktj928dkczjz7yvgr7a4ufru0u4s8atttq3ec445
transaction
8c20dfd799e5237170c397bfb54756dcab0c7294d9bd6c5b53036b354cd8d0b0
confirmations
54630
spent
true